There are 14 members in a yoga training centre. Four members of it leave and 6 new members join the centre. As a result, the average age of the members of the centre decreases by 5 years and the sum of all members also decreases by 20 years. What is the new average age of the members?

  1. 28 years

  2. 27 years

  3. 25 years

  4. 29 years

  5. 24 years

Explanation

Let S be the initial sum of ages. Initial average = S/14. New sum = S - 20. New number of members = 14 - 4 + 6 = 16. New average = (S-20)/16. Given S/14 - (S-20)/16 = 5. 16S - 14(S-20) = 5 * 14 * 16 = 1120. 2S + 280 = 1120 => 2S = 840 => S = 420. New average = (420-20)/16 = 400/16 = 25.

Let the initial average age be A, so the original sum of the ages of the 14 members is 14 multiplied by A. The new sum of the ages after 4 members leave and 6 join is 16 multiplied by (A - 5), which expands to 16A minus 80; the problem also states this new sum equals the original sum minus 20, giving us the equation 14A minus 20 equals 16A minus 80. Solving for A gives an original average age of 30 years, so the new average age is 30 minus 5, resulting in 25 years.
